diff options
author | Jason Huebel <jhuebel@gentoo.org> | 2004-04-01 16:45:28 +0000 |
---|---|---|
committer | Jason Huebel <jhuebel@gentoo.org> | 2004-04-01 16:45:28 +0000 |
commit | c47b2a22e4ebbda9dfbe4a4ce21d118e56aed4dd (patch) | |
tree | d905984ad1fcca1a13ce44b4adbf17ad945a0cd6 /sys-apps/xmbmon/xmbmon-2.0.3.ebuild | |
parent | Removed explicit S= (Manifest recommit) (diff) | |
download | gentoo-2-c47b2a22e4ebbda9dfbe4a4ce21d118e56aed4dd.tar.gz gentoo-2-c47b2a22e4ebbda9dfbe4a4ce21d118e56aed4dd.tar.bz2 gentoo-2-c47b2a22e4ebbda9dfbe4a4ce21d118e56aed4dd.zip |
fixes so linux ifdefs are used and added gnuconfig_update
Diffstat (limited to 'sys-apps/xmbmon/xmbmon-2.0.3.ebuild')
-rw-r--r-- | sys-apps/xmbmon/xmbmon-2.0.3.ebuild | 12 |
1 files changed, 8 insertions, 4 deletions
diff --git a/sys-apps/xmbmon/xmbmon-2.0.3.ebuild b/sys-apps/xmbmon/xmbmon-2.0.3.ebuild index 6f21467b687e..a8e79f2256f0 100644 --- a/sys-apps/xmbmon/xmbmon-2.0.3.ebuild +++ b/sys-apps/xmbmon/xmbmon-2.0.3.ebuild @@ -1,6 +1,8 @@ -# Copyright 1999-2003 Gentoo Technologies, Inc. +# Copyright 1999-2004 Gentoo Technologies, Inc. #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/xmbmon/xmbmon-2.0.3.ebuild,v 1.3 2004/01/13 05:21:25 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/xmbmon/xmbmon-2.0.3.ebuild,v 1.4 2004/04/01 16:45:28 jhuebel Exp $ + +inherit gnuconfig MY_P="${PN}${PV//.}" DESCRIPTION="Mother Board Monitor Program for X Window System" @@ -18,10 +20,12 @@ DEPEND="virtual/glibc S=${WORKDIR}/${MY_P} src_compile() { + gnuconfig_update + econf || die "Configure failed" - emake CFLAGS="$CFLAGS \$(INCLUDES) \$(DEFS)" mbmon || die "Make mbmon failed" + emake DEFS="$DEFS -DLINUX" CFLAGS="$CFLAGS \$(INCLUDES) \$(DEFS)" mbmon || die "Make mbmon failed" if [ `use X` ] ; then - emake CFLAGSX="$CFLAGS \$(INCLUDES) \$(DEFS)" xmbmon || die "Make xmbmon failed" + emake DEFS="$DEFS -DLINUX" CFLAGSX="$CFLAGS \$(INCLUDES) \$(DEFS)" xmbmon || die "Make xmbmon failed" fi } |